SIMI-Indian Mujahideen terrorists enter Delhi amid massive CAA protests: Intelligence Bureau warns
India | December 21, 2019 22:10 ISTSoon after the notification about the presence of possible terrorists was issued, the Gautam Budh Nagar Police have constituted 42 teams at all 21 police stations, wherein each team would comprise of 8 to 10 police personnel.